How Much Does a Transformer Household Energy Storage System Cost

Summary: Transformer household energy storage systems typically cost between $8,000 and $25,000, depending on capacity, battery type, and installation complexity. This article breaks down pricing factors, industry trends, and practical tips for homeowners considering renewable energy solutions.

Breaking Down the Cost of Transformer Energy Storage Systems

If you're exploring energy independence or backup power solutions, understanding the cost of a transformer household energy storage system is crucial. Let's dive into what drives pricing and how you can optimize your investment.

Key Cost Components

  • Battery Type: Lithium-ion (most common) vs. lead-acid
  • Capacity: 5kWh to 20kWh systems
  • Installation: Labor, permits, and grid integration
  • Inverter: Converts DC to AC power

2024 Market Price Ranges

CapacityLithium-ion CostLead-acid Cost
5kWh$8,000–$12,000$4,500–$7,000
10kWh$14,000–$18,000$8,000–$11,000
20kWh$22,000–$25,000+$15,000–$18,000
"Lithium-ion batteries dominate 78% of new installations due to longer lifespans and higher efficiency." – 2023 Global Energy Storage Report

Why Costs Vary: Hidden Factors You Should Know

While battery capacity is the obvious cost driver, these often-overlooked elements impact your final price:

  • Local electricity rates (higher rates = faster ROI)
  • Government incentives (up to 30% tax credits in some regions)
  • Hybrid systems combining solar + storage

Case Study: California Homeowner Savings

A 12kWh system installed in San Diego:

  • Upfront cost: $16,200
  • Federal tax credit: $4,860
  • Annual savings: $1,400 on utility bills
  • ROI period: 8.1 years

Future-Proofing Your Investment

With battery prices dropping 7% annually (BloombergNEF data), here's how to balance current costs with future needs:

  1. Choose modular systems for easy capacity upgrades
  2. Prioritize smart energy management software
  3. Verify warranty terms (look for 10-year coverage)

FAQs: Transformer Household Energy Storage Costs

Q: How long do these systems typically last?

A: Lithium-ion systems last 10–15 years, with lead-acid needing replacement every 3–7 years.

Q: Can I get financing for energy storage?

A: Many providers offer lease-to-own options or low-interest green energy loans.

Q: What maintenance costs should I expect?

A: Annual inspections ($150–$300) and occasional software updates (usually free).
